/netbsd/sys/compat/linux/arch/alpha/ |
H A D | linux_machdep.h | 42 struct linux_sigcontext { struct 68 struct linux_sigcontext uc_mcontext; argument 82 struct linux_sigcontext sf_sc; 99 int linux_restore_sigcontext(struct lwp *, struct linux_sigcontext,
|
H A D | linux_machdep.c | 242 memset(&sigframe.sf_sc, 0, sizeof(struct linux_sigcontext)); in setup_linux_sigframe() 364 linux_restore_sigcontext(struct lwp *l, struct linux_sigcontext context, in linux_restore_sigcontext()
|
/netbsd/sys/compat/linux/arch/mips/ |
H A D | linux_machdep.h | 43 struct linux_sigcontext { /* N32 too */ struct 67 linux_sigcontext argument 111 struct linux_sigcontext lsf_sc; 131 struct linux_sigcontext luc_mcontext; 148 struct linux_sigcontext luc_mcontext;
|
H A D | linux_machdep.c | 122 linux_setup_sigcontext(struct linux_sigcontext *sc, in linux_setup_sigcontext() 257 const struct linux_sigcontext *sc) in linux_putaway_sigcontext()
|
/netbsd/sys/compat/linux/arch/m68k/ |
H A D | linux_machdep.h | 44 struct linux_sigcontext { struct 80 struct linux_sigcontext *sf_scp; /* context ptr for handler */ argument 87 struct linux_sigcontext c_sc; /* actual context */
|
H A D | linux_machdep.c | 505 struct linux_sigcontext *scp; /* pointer to sigcontext */ in linux_sys_sigreturn()
|
/netbsd/sys/compat/linux/arch/i386/ |
H A D | linux_machdep.h | 77 struct linux_sigcontext { struct 124 struct linux_sigcontext uc_mcontext; 146 struct linux_sigcontext sf_sc;
|
H A D | linux_machdep.c | 114 const sigset_t *, struct linux_sigcontext *); 116 struct linux_sigcontext *, register_t *); 191 const sigset_t *mask, struct linux_sigcontext *sc) in linux_save_sigcontext() 411 struct linux_sigcontext context, *scp = SCARG(uap, scp); in linux_sys_sigreturn() 425 linux_restore_sigcontext(struct lwp *l, struct linux_sigcontext *scp, in linux_restore_sigcontext()
|
H A D | linux_syscallargs.h | 438 syscallarg(struct linux_sigcontext *) scp;
|
/netbsd/sys/compat/linux/arch/arm/ |
H A D | linux_machdep.h | 37 struct linux_sigcontext { struct 69 struct linux_sigcontext sf_sc; argument
|
H A D | linux_syscallargs.h | 421 syscallarg(struct linux_sigcontext *) scp;
|
/netbsd/sys/compat/linux/arch/powerpc/ |
H A D | linux_machdep.h | 66 struct linux_sigcontext { struct 145 struct linux_sigcontext luc_context;
|
H A D | linux_machdep.c | 114 struct linux_sigcontext sc; in linux_sendsig() 220 fp -= sizeof(struct linux_sigcontext); in linux_sendsig() 221 error = copyout(&sc, (void *)fp, sizeof (struct linux_sigcontext)); in linux_sendsig() 370 struct linux_sigcontext *scp, context; in linux_sys_sigreturn()
|
H A D | linux_syscallargs.h | 396 syscallarg(struct linux_sigcontext *) scp;
|
/netbsd/sys/compat/linux/arch/amd64/ |
H A D | linux_machdep.h | 61 struct linux_sigcontext { struct 97 struct linux_sigcontext luc_mcontext; argument
|
H A D | linux_machdep.c | 318 struct linux_sigcontext *lsigctx; in linux_sys_rt_sigreturn()
|
/netbsd/sys/compat/linux/arch/aarch64/ |
H A D | linux_machdep.h | 52 struct linux_sigcontext { struct 68 struct linux_sigcontext luc_mcontext; argument
|
H A D | linux_machdep.c | 57 linux_save_sigcontext(struct lwp *l, struct linux_sigcontext *ctx) in linux_save_sigcontext() 92 struct linux_sigcontext *ctx = &luc->luc_mcontext; in aarch64_linux_to_native_ucontext()
|